What Does It Require to Keep Up Good Oral Health?
Dr. Corbet Ellison, pediatric dentist and founder of Shadow Creek Ranch Dental Specialists, wonders why people always seem to be able to schedule several hours a day or numerous weekly hours for the gym or even set aside time to not miss their favorite TV show, but not enough people take the time to brush twice daily for at least three minutes, or even take just two minutes to floss to remove hard to reach plaque and food that can become stuck in between teeth. It is merely a few minutes each day that can actually extend your life and, more importantly, to extend the quality of your life.
“We have to start correlating and putting that in our schedule and putting that as a priority and not just as one of those things we don’t have to do because we don’t have that instant reaction when we don’t do it,” Dr. Ellison said.
